Draw would have been alright before kick off so under the circumstances can't complain although it is frustrating to have lost the lead twice.

Can't fault any of our players performances with Richarlison and Keane the stand outs. 

Wolves are absolutely bang average outside of Neves. How they can sign so many players and end up with that defence is a mystery. Patricio is a good goalkeeper but that back line I saw on the teamsheets and instantly felt better about our chances. I assumed they'd have some decent defenders the way all the pundits have been going on this summer but once again, I don't know why I put any stock by what those village idiots have to say.

If you can't beat last season's Everton team (plus Richarlison but apparently he's shite anyway) who won about 2 games away from home all season and played more than half the game with ten men and Holgate who isn't even fit playing the rest of the game at centre back, then you can forget about your rampage to 7th place. It's only one game today but I've seen nothing there to distinguish them from any other side that have come up recently, only Ruben Neves.

Still not convinced about the red card and replays now showing that Neves took the free kick from five yards closer to goal than the actual location of the foul so Wolves can't argue they didn't get any luck on their cup final day (and that's not because it's us, it's the same with any newly promoted side in their first home game).

I'm happy with our guts and some of our play out there though. Plenty to be positive about with Mina, Bernard and Gomes to join the fray as well. Keane and Schneiderlin will be like (cliche alert) new signings as well if they can play like they did today which was a major departure from their performances last season.

Well, still not sure what to make of this game. I'm not sure if I agree with the red card as contact was made with the ball first. What a goal from Neves though. Poor from the ref to allow Neves to take the free kick from where he wanted though.

A lot of the plaudits have got Neves' way and rightly so, but Richarlison seems to have gone a long way to suggesting he can repay the fee paid for him. It seems like Marco Silva is the one that knows how to get the best out of him.

I expect to see both teams improve from this. Wolves have had a lot of new faces to introduce, and Everton still have their deadline day faces to follow.
